How they compare
ESCWA: Arab Countries (unsdcode:98501) currently reports 67.4% against 65.6% in Zimbabwe, a difference of 1.8%.
The two have swapped places 3 times across 14 shared years of data; in 1984 it was Zimbabwe ahead.
ESCWA: Arab Countries (unsdcode:98501) ranks 138th and Zimbabwe ranks 139th of 219 groups.
Zimbabwe has averaged higher in every one of the 3 decades both report.
Head to head by decade
| Decade | ESCWA: Arab Countries (unsdcode:98501) | Zimbabwe | Difference | Ahead |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 1980s | 50.1% | 52.5% | 2.4% | Zimbabwe |
| 2010s | 63.2% | 63.5% | 0.3% | Zimbabwe |
| 2020s | 66.6% | 67.4% | 0.8% | Zimbabwe |
Averages of every year both report within each decade.
